§ 32 §4700-B — Disposal of fees
Maine·Title 32 PROFESSIONS AND OCCUPATIONS·Ch. 69-B REGULATIONS OF THE SALE OF BUSINESS OPPORTUNITIES
All fees received under this chapter shall be paid to the Treasurer of State to be used for carrying out this chapter. Any balance of these fees shall not lapse, but shall be carried forward as a continuing account to be expended for the same purposes in the following fiscal years.
